On August 18, former Georgian Dream leader and former Prime Minister Irakli Garibashvili has issued another statement, which he announced yesterday.
Garibashvili says that the letter published yesterday was sent to him in July by one of Georgian Dream’s leaders, Mamuka Mdinaradze.
According to Garibashvili, the main aim of the “fight against corruption” campaign was to put him in prison and “politically destroy” him, and he says he did everything he could to avoid “entering into confrontation with the team and a person dear to me.”
The former prime minister says he is being “forced” to begin fighting.
Netgazeti publishes the letter in full:
“I want to tell the public the truth about why I am in prison. The main aim of the so-called ‘fight against corruption’ campaign launched last year was to put me in prison and politically destroy me.
I state with full responsibility that I did everything I could to avoid entering into confrontation with the team and with a person dear to me. It was precisely for this reason that I refused to fight the case and allowed myself to be carried along by the process, which was devastating for me, so as not to harm the interests of the state or the team, so as not to harm the interests of the state or the team..
Unfortunately, in return I received a staged, dirty provocation, a great deal of lies and injustice. Throughout this entire period, the public heard not a single word from me. I endured this tribulation with complete patience.
But unexpectedly for me, in July I received the letter I published yesterday, which was sent to me by Mamuka Mdinaradze. That same day, I made my position known to him, once again stated clearly that I had no intention of returning to politics, and offered my own view as a way of insuring against the aforementioned ‘risk.’ But in response, I was told that there still remained a 1% risk that I would return to politics, and that, to guard against this, it was necessary to bring corruption charges against me and for me to admit to them.
That was the red line that led me to take the most difficult step of my life. Therefore, they are leaving me no choice but to fight…”
